Private Walking Tour of Edinburgh's Old Town

Duration: 4 hours
Restrictions: not suitable for strollers or wheelchairs

Come and experience the hidden secrets of this beautiful medieval city on a private walking tour. Discover the numerous highlights along the Royal Mile and relive the Middle Ages!

Highlights

  • Walk through Edinburgh's Georgian New Town en route to the Old Town
  • Visit ancient graveyards and churches and be moved by stories of courage and sacrifice, grandeur and poverty.
  • Mon-Fri visit the amazing former Parliament Hall, now used by the legal profession
  • Visit St Giles cathedral
  • Discover the courtyard from where coaches used to transport travelers down to London to Scotland Yard in London
  • Visit Greyfriars Kirkyard - famous for Harry Potter fans
  • Visit the Royal Museum of Scotland
  • Stroll down the Royal Mile, past the new Scottish Parliament and arrive at the Royal Palace of Holyrood House
